“Keeping Families Together”

11 September 2018 News

On September 4-5, 2018 the UNICEF Office in Armeniaр  the Ministry of Labor and Social Affairs of the Republic of Armenia with the support of the Bulgarian embassy in Armenia  organized an international conference “Keeping Families Together” in DoubleTree by Hilton Hotel, Yerevan.  The international conference was held in the frames of the project implemented by UNICEF-Armenia under the bilateral development cooperation aid of Bulgaria for Armenia. The project provides for activities in the following areas: support for the Armenian reforms in moving away from the specialized institutions and adopt alternative care models through the exchange of visits and good practices between line ministries, municipal authorities and other providers of social services for children. On the basis of the lessons learnt from the Bulgarian and other countries experiences, the UNICEF Office in Armenia has to launch a pilot project for introducing a family-like model for raising children without parental care in Armenia for up to 10 children. The experience of Bulgaria can be useful for Armenia  due to the similarities in traditions and cultures between Armenian and Bulgarian people.

The Ambassador Maria Pavlova addressed the audience emphasizing the significance of the project and the opportunities provided for Bulgaria and Armenia to share experiences and good practices in an area which is vital for the promotion od children’s rights and children wellbeing.

The keynote speech at the conference was delivered  by the Deputy Minister of Labor and Social Affairs of Bulgaria Mrs. Zornitsa Roussionova. The Bulgarian Deputy Minister highlighted the complex nature of the reform in the childcare and child protection sector and presented an updated information on deinstitutionalization process, the number of children in foster care and the level of community based services  for children. Several experts from the academia and NGO sector in Bulgaria shared their views and  observations on the applicability of the Bulgarian experience in Armenia. The project implementation will continue with the conduct of a study visit of Armenian officials and NGO representatives to Bulgaria.
